                          So heres an update!

                          Finally finished the PI Intake/80mm MAF conversion, and got it tuned. Went with MPT and thier 93 Octane tune. Couldn't be happier! Car is so much more fun now, and with the SCT tuner I have I can change tire sizes, Gear raios (3.73s are upcoming) and other cool stuff. Totally worth it!
